Payhawk and Ramp serve distinctly different market segments in the spend management space. Payhawk excels as a sophisticated platform for multinational organizations, offering robust cross-border expense management and complex organizational structure support. Its strength lies in handling international currencies and maintaining consistent policies across multiple entities.

Ramp, on the other hand, stands out as the superior choice for US-based companies seeking streamlined operations, offering exceptional ease of use, advanced AI-driven automation, and seamless integration capabilities. While both platforms provide comprehensive spend management features, Payhawk is better suited for large, complex international organizations, while Ramp is ideal for fast-growing US companies prioritizing user-friendly automation and domestic operations.

Advantages of Ramp

Ramp is significantly more user-friendly than Payhawk
With an ease of use that far exceeds Payhawk, we find Ramp offers a more intuitive experience requiring minimal training. This makes it particularly valuable for fast-growing companies that need to quickly onboard new employees to their expense management system.
Ramp has superior AI-driven expense categorization compared to Payhawk
While Payhawk offers standard categorization, Ramp's AI-powered system is more advanced, automatically matching receipts and drafting memos with minimal human intervention. This saves significant time for finance teams managing high volumes of expenses.
Ramp provides better integration capabilities than Payhawk
Ramp offers seamless connections to major accounting systems and business tools, enabling companies to maintain their existing tech stack while automating financial workflows with exceptional ease.

Payhawk is best for

  • Businesses with multinational operations requiring sophisticated expense management across European entities
  • Who need granular budget control with real-time tracking across multiple cost centers
  • And/or who need competitive FX rates with sophisticated card management across currencies

Ramp is best for

  • US headquartered businesses with rapid growth seeking AI-powered expense automation and real-time spend controls
  • Who need granular spending controls at department and vendor levels
  • And/or who need seamless integration with major accounting platforms

Payhawk is less good for

  • Businesses with simple domestic spending needs seeking a basic expense management solution
  • Who need a quick plug-and-play solution without extensive setup or training
  • And/or who need a highly simplified interface with minimal features

Ramp is less good for

  • Non-US headquartered businesses
  • Who need extensive customization of their chart of accounts and expense categories
  • And/or who need advanced mobile app features with a lot of flexibility

<p>Ramp integrates seamlessly with major accounting systems and other tools, reducing manual work significantly. It offers out-of-the-box connections to QuickBooks, Xero, Sage Intacct, and more, syncing transactions and receipts with a click. The platform also hooks into email and Slack for receipt forwarding and notifications, showing a strong commitment to fitting into your existing tech stack.</p>
